By using factor theorem in the following example, determine whether q(x) is a factor p(x) or not.

p(x) = x3 − x2 − x − 1, q(x) = x − 1

उत्तर

p(x) = x3 − x2 − x − 1

Divisor = q(x) = x − 1

∴ p(1) = (1)3 - (1)2 − 1 − 1

= 1 − 1 − 1 − 1

= − 2 ≠ 0

Since p(1) ≠ 0, so by factor theorem q(x) = x − 1 is not a factor of polynomial p(x) = x3 − x2 − x − 1.
